Output 21d307983877cf32dfdfb51700984dcb7fda268361e6de060df1418dfa5d402b:0

value
330951
script pubkey
OP_0 OP_PUSHBYTES_20 041a69bf61df58482c46b0fda1abba44aee731db
address
bc1qqsdxn0mpmavystzxkr76r2a6gjhwwvwm562yej
transaction
21d307983877cf32dfdfb51700984dcb7fda268361e6de060df1418dfa5d402b
spent
true